Russian Army stationed openly and freely on Israel’s border

The recent escalation of military tensions in the region has been marked by a surge in Israeli Defense Forces (IDF) activity and attacks in southern Syria. Unlike previous attacks that were carried out under a veil of ambiguity, the IDF has recently announced a series of direct strikes against Syrian army targets. Pro-Iranian militias have also become more active in the region, with attacks against Israel emanating from the Golan Heights area over the past six months.

Meanwhile, Russian military forces have been steadily increasing their presence in southern Syria, particularly in Kunitra and Daraa. The deployment of Russian troops coincides with growing protests against President Assad’s regime in the Daraa region, which have been met with repression by authorities. In November, after a two-year absence, Russia resumed its activities in southern Syria, providing support to Assad’s army in regaining control of the Golan Heights area.

The close cooperation between Russia and Syria has been evident in their joint efforts to combat opposition forces, including airstrikes targeting areas such as Idlib. The renewed Russian presence near the Israeli border could potentially lead to increased tensions between Jerusalem and Moscow. Despite this, Russia has taken an anti-Israel stance and issued condemnation notices to Israel for its recent actions.

As concerns about security coordination between Israel and Russia grow, tensions between Jerusalem and Moscow are expected to continue to escalate. This is particularly significant given the growing presence of pro-Iranian militias in the region and their potential involvement in any future military conflicts or provocations.
